This document contains a detailed description of an ASCII Character Buffer Interface designed to store and forward serial ASCII data received from an EIA RS-232C Interface. The particular application described herein concerns a Perkin-Elmer Model 5000 Atomic Absorption instrument transmitting ASCII data to the Data General EPA Laboratory Automation System. The interface is a part of a larger atomic absorption computer automation system which is currently in operation at the Environmental Protection Agency, Environmental Monitoring and Support Laboratory, Cincinnati. Software has been developed on the multi-user Basic language system for atomic absorption instrument applications. Applications include 'on line' data reduction, quality control, report generation and sample file control. The interface, however, may be used in any application involving the need to store and forward ASCII information. |
